dc.description.abstractThe research explores recent advancements in the field of water desalination, a critical element in addressing the growing demand for fresh water on a global scale. With dwindling freshwater resources, it becomes imperative to explore more efficient and environmentallyrespectful approaches to produce potable water from seawater or brackish water. The study then focuses on emerging modern desalination techniques, including enhanced reverse osmosis through the use of innovative membranes, low-energy consumption desalination processes like electrodialysis, and multi-effect thermal desalination technologies. Each of these approaches is examined in detail, emphasizing their advantages, limitations, and potential for large-scale implementation. Sustainability is at the core of this study, exploring the environmental and economic implications of these new desalination techniques. It also delves into progress in the valorization of by-products from desalination, contributing to minimizing the impact on local ecosystems.en_US
